On name confusion:

My given name is Jian Wei and my surname is Gan. In Chinese, the surname, or family name, is written (and spoken) before the given name, so my name in Chinese is Gan Jian Wei. However, in many western countries such as the USA, the given name is the "first name" and the surname is the "last name." Following this use of "first" and "last," my name should be Jian Wei Gan, and that's in fact what I use on my resume.

You can just call me Wei.
